You may only build an ender portal with the use of creative mode in version 12w23a and above (when you download the game it is on version 1.2.5 and must be updated manually to get 12w23a or above snapshots) or by the use of third-party tools/mods. In creating a world (not classic minecraft) the game creates a ender portals that randomly spawns once for each of the three randomly created strongholds. They are created as follows: □ □ □ □ □ □ □ □ □ □ □ □ With the use of an 'Eye of Ender' you can travel the a place called 'The End' by placing one eye of ender in each block (right click). When the ender portal is spawned it may have some Eye of Ender already in it. They are unbreakable in vanilla survival mode so you can't get the block. _______________________________________________________________ Answer in short: Not as soon as you download minecraft, but with 12w23a or above then you can on creative mode. It is able to get with use of a mod on any version as long as it was built for that version.
